CEP Report Explores History, Tactics of Al-Qaeda in the Indian Subcontinent

CEP released new resources documenting the formation, structure and tactics of al-Qaeda in the Indian Subcontinent (AQIS), and its mysterious, Indian-born emir, Asim Omar. AQIS is al-Qaeda's fifth official chapter.

European Responses to Terror Examines Europe’s Policies on Extremist Violence

CEP today released the report, European Responses to Terror, a detailed examination of European government policy responses to acts of political and religious violence from the end of World War II to the present.

CEP Resource Details History, Ideology of Global Islamist Movement Hizb ut-Tahrir

CEP released a new resource detailing the history, leadership, growth and beliefs of Hizb ut-Tahrir, an Islamist organization operating in 40 countries that advocates for the establishment of a global caliphate.
